Smart Water Conservation: Utilizing a Rainwater Collection Tank

Rainwater harvesting systems, often incorporating reservoirs, offer a sustainable and cost-effective method to manage water resources. By capturing and storing rainwater from rooftops, these systems mitigate reliance on municipal supplies and promote water conservation. The collected rainwater can be utilized for various purposes, such as irrigation, toilet flushing, and laundry, effectively reducing household water consumption. Furthermore, installation of a rainwater tank system often promotes significant financial savings by lowering water bills. In addition to its practical benefits, rainwater harvesting contributes to environmental sustainability by reducing stormwater runoff and minimizing the strain on local water infrastructure.

  • Benefits of implementing a rainwater tank system include:
  • Reduced reliance on municipal water sources
  • Financial benefits
  • Environmental sustainability through reduced stormwater runoff
  • Increased availability of water for non-potable uses

Optimizing Water Usage with Underground Water Storage Tanks

Conserving water is a essential aspect of sustainable living, and implementing efficient hydrological management systems can make a significant impact. One innovative solution gaining momentum is the utilization of underground water storage tanks. These subterranean reservoirs offer a spectrum of benefits, including rainwater harvesting, gray water reuse, and supplemental water provision during periods of drought or water constraint.

  • Effectively placed underground tanks can effectively capture and store rainwater runoff, reducing surface discharge and replenishing groundwater reserves.

  • Gray water from household appliances, such as showers, sinks, and washing machines, can be processed and stored in underground tanks for reuse in landscaping, minimizing freshwater consumption.
  • Additionally, these tanks provide a reliable reserve water source during emergencies or periods of water restriction, ensuring continued access to clean water for essential needs.

Investing underground water storage tanks is a wise investment in water conservation and sustainability, leading to long-term cost reductions and a decreased environmental footprint.
